High in the Clouds
Paul McCartney, Philip Ardagh, and Geoff Dunbar
When his homeland is destroyed, Wirral the Squirrel sets off to find Animalia, a land where all animals can live in peace. With the help of a frog with a hot air balloon, a clever rat, and a red squirrel, Wirral eventually decides they must free all the enslaved animals.
Killers of the Flower Moon
David Grann
If you are looking for exciting new movies based on books, you should keep your eye out for this true crime story about the fascinating case of the Osage murders in the 1920s. After discovering oil on their land, the Osage Indian Nation in Oklahoma was among the richest people in the world at the time. Once the death toll surpasses 24 Osage, the newly created FBI takes up the investigation to expose an alarming conspiracy behind these notorious crimes. Filming was delayed until early 2021, so it’s likely Martin’s Scorsese’s film adaptation starring Leonardo DiCaprio and Robert De Niro will come out in 2022.

The Nightingale
Kristin Hannah
Set in a small village in occupied France, the story centers around two sisters. Forced to house a German officer in her home, the older sister Vianne Mauriac must decide, to protect her daughter, where exactly she should draw the line of being complicit with German demands. On the other hand, her younger sister Isabelle Rossignol feels committed to doing anything she can to resist the German occupation. Unfortunately, The Nightingale‘s 2022 release date was canceled again, so I don’t think it will actually be a book becoming a movie this year.
Persuasion
Jane Austen
One of the classic books soon to be movies is a new adaptation of Jane Austen’s Persuasion. Eight years ago, Anne Elliott let herself be persuaded out of an engagement with the poor naval officer Frederick Wentworth, a decision she has long regretted. When Wentworth returns as a rich and successful sea captain, he finds the Elliott family on the brink of financial ruin. Will Anne and Wentworth rekindle their romance or has she missed her chance?
